What is Sysco Long-Term Capital Lease Obligation?

Sysco's Long-Term Capital Lease Obligation for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was $737 Mil.

Sysco's quarterly Long-Term Capital Lease Obligation increased from Jun. 2023 ($656 Mil) to Sep. 2023 ($696 Mil) and increased from Sep. 2023 ($696 Mil) to Dec. 2023 ($737 Mil).

Sysco's annual Long-Term Capital Lease Obligation increased from Jun. 2021 ($634 Mil) to Jun. 2022 ($636 Mil) and increased from Jun. 2022 ($636 Mil) to Jun. 2023 ($656 Mil).

Sysco  (NYSE:SYY) Long-Term Capital Lease Obligation Explanation

Long-Term Capital Lease Obligation are the amount due for long-term asset lease agreements that are nearly equivalent to asset purchases. Capital lease obligations are installment payments that constitute a payment of principal plus interest for the capital lease. The Short-Term Capital Lease Obligation is the portion of a Long-Term Capital Lease Obligation that is due over the next year.

Under US Generally Accepted Accounting Principles (GAAP), a capital lease is essentially equivalent to a purchase by the lessee if it meets the following criteria:

1. Ownership of the asset is transferred to the lessee at the end of the lease term;
2. The lease contains a bargain purchase option to buy the equipment at less than fair market value;
3. The lease term equals or exceeds 75% of the asset's estimated useful life;
4. The present value of the lease payments equals or exceeds 90% of the total original cost of the equipment.

Sysco is the largest U.S. foodservice distributor with 17% share of the highly fragmented $350 billion domestic market. Sysco distributes roughly 500,000 food and nonfood products to restaurants (62% of fiscal 2023 revenue), education and government buildings (8%), travel and leisure (8%), healthcare facilities (7%) and other locations (15%) where individuals consume away-from-home meals. In fiscal 2023, 70% of the firm's revenue was derived from its U.S. foodservice operations, while its international (18%), quick-service logistics (10%), and other (2%) segments made up the difference.
